This was our third cruise, but first with Serenade of the Seas. My wife and I along with her sister and her husband traveled together to celebrate our Silver Wedding Anniversary (9/22/79). Our other two cruises were aboard the Carnival Fantasy and Jubilee (1994 & 2003). Although Carnival was a very good cruise line, RCI just had a different flavor, or maybe it was because of our destination and most travelers were adults. There were very few children on this cruise. Carnival is a party cruise line sort of Las Vegas style, while RCI was more subdued and laid back. We enjoy both flavors.

The Serenade of the Seas was magnificent in beauty and an engineering marvel. The onboard TV had a special about the building of one of their ships where I learned about the engineering.

Our cruise aboard the Serenade was to Alaska. The shore excursions were only OK because the weather was beginning to get cold and it was rainy for the most part, but the beauty was indescribable. We had a cabin with a balcony and we were able to view the scenery if only for short periods because of the temperature. The weather turned ugly in the Gulf of Alaska and the ship did a lot of pitching and rowing. We loved it though and found it to be very relaxing especially at night in bed. It just sort of rocked us to sleep. Some were seasick though. I am an old Navy salt and had no problem with that.
